摘 要:目的探讨3D MR减影技术的头部应用价值。方法 67例脑内占位病变患者分别行3D平扫和增强,增强的图像减平扫的图像得3D MRSI。67例病变分为两组:T1WI平扫高信号组(32例)和非高信号组(35例),比较两组原始图像和减影图像间对信号反应的差异改变,并进行统计学分析。结果 T1WI平扫高信号组(32例)显示在增强前后仅有15.62%能在常规图像反应出病变强化的信号改变,84.38%(27/32)在MR减影图像上能反映病灶强化,有统计学差异(P<0.05);T1WI非高信号组(35例)在常规和减影图像均能显示病变强化分别为93.72%(179/191)和94.24%(180/191),无统计学差异(P>0.05)。结论 3DMR减影对强化前后病灶显示在T1WI平扫高信号组优于常规图像,而在T1WI非高信号病变基本相一致。Objective to explore the applicaton value of 3D MR subtraction imaging technique in brain. Methods 3D MRIs (3D MR subtraction imaging) were obtained in 67 patients with brain lesion by using pre-T1WI and post-T1WI. 319 MR-SI was obtained by subtracting from post-T1WI 3D MR_Ira pre-T1WI 3D MRI. 67 patients were divided into two groups:one is lesion with hyper--signal on TIWI and another is non hyper-signal on T1WI.Different signal changes between two groups on traditional MRI (pre-T 1WI and post-T1WI) and its subtraction were compared and analyzed statistically, Results In hyper--signal (on T1WI) grbup (32 cases), only 15.62% enhanced lesions was displayed m the conventionalimage, and 84:38% (27/32) was showed reflect on 3D MR. subtraction image, significant difference between them (p〈0:05); In non hiper-signal group (35 cases), the enhanced lesions were displayed 93.72% (179/191) and 94.24% (180/191) by MR conventionJ and mbtracfion image, no significant difference (e〉0.05). Conclusion 3D MRSI is superior to traditional MR. on lesion hyper-'signal group on TIWI, and is the same as traditional MR on non lesion hyper-signal group on T1WI.
